Output 210858b8a0227811295c1484fde29c933d2a53c0d8179ad4755c994a50e2ce7b:26

value
120171616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57bacfa5553263251b387f0face6553ea74f607 OP_EQUAL
address
3JEcPQKt7GdtUH7JbJPERkDWD8AZtRRYUX
transaction
210858b8a0227811295c1484fde29c933d2a53c0d8179ad4755c994a50e2ce7b
spent
true